About This Event
A comprehensive 3½-day advanced surgical education program focused on lower extremity surgery. The symposium features 2½ days of expert-led lectures on topics including total ankle replacement, complex deformity correction, Charcot reconstruction, and limb salvage techniques, followed by a full day of hands-on cadaveric laboratory training for surgeons and specialists.
